Sourcing guidance for Rechargeable Ceiling Fan
How to choose the right battery capacity and motor type for a rechargeable ceiling fan?
When sourcing rechargeable ceiling fans, the battery capacity (measured in mAh or Ah) and motor technology are the most critical factors. You should prioritize Brushless DC (BLDC) motors, as they are up to 50% more energy-efficient than traditional AC motors, significantly extending the battery life per charge. For the battery, ensure the supplier uses Lithium Iron Phosphate (LiFePO4) or Lithium-ion batteries with a capacity of at least 10,000mAh to 20,000mAh to guarantee a runtime of 6-12 hours on low to medium speeds during power outages.
What are the essential compliance standards and certifications for international markets?
To ensure legal entry and consumer safety, products must meet specific regional standards. For the US market, look for UL 507 (electric fans) and FCC certification. For the EU market, CE marking (LVD and EMC directives) and RoHS compliance are mandatory. Since these products contain batteries, they must also have UN38.3 certification and an MSDS (Material Safety Data Sheet) for safe international transport.
What functional features should B2B buyers prioritize for high-end markets?
To differentiate your product, look for fans with multi-speed settings (at least 3-5 levels), remote control functionality, and integrated LED lighting. Advanced models should include USB output ports to serve as a power bank for mobile devices. Additionally, check for AC/DC dual-mode operation, allowing the fan to run directly from the grid while simultaneously charging the internal battery.
How can I verify the durability and build quality of the fan blades and housing?
Request suppliers to provide ABS plastic or reinforced PP material specifications for the blades to prevent warping in high-temperature environments. For the housing, anti-UV treatment is essential if the fans are intended for semi-outdoor use (like verandas). Ask for salt spray test reports if the target market is in a coastal region to ensure the metal components are corrosion-resistant.
Cross-Border Purchasing Considerations for Rechargeable Fans
What are the specific risks associated with shipping products containing large lithium batteries?
Rechargeable fans are classified as Dangerous Goods (Class 9) due to the lithium batteries. This often leads to higher shipping costs and stricter documentation requirements. You must ensure your freight forwarder is experienced in handling battery-integrated cargo and that the packaging meets IATA/IMDG standards to avoid seizure at customs or safety incidents during transit.
How can I mitigate quality risks when dealing with new overseas suppliers?
Always utilize third-party inspection services (such as V-Trust or SGS) to conduct a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I). Focus on a battery cycle test and a charging safety test to ensure the units do not overheat. What negotiation strategies work best for bulk orders of electronic appliances?
Negotiate based on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Ask for a 1-2% spare parts allowance (especially for remote controls and charging cables) to be included in the price. If you are ordering over 1,000 units, push for OEM branding and customized packaging at no extra cost, and request a warranty period of at least 12-24 months.
How do international trade policies and tariffs affect the final landed cost?
Check the HS Code (typically 8414.51) for your specific country to determine the import duty rates. Be aware of Anti-Dumping duties that some regions may impose on electrical fans from specific origins. Always calculate the Landed Cost, which includes the factory price, shipping, insurance, and local taxes, before finalizing the purchase contract.
